Understanding the Different Types of UK Driving Licences

The UK operates a分级 system for driving licences, with various classifications enabling holders to run numerous car types. For the majority of personal automobiles, the basic Category B licence covers cars and lorries with a maximum weight of 3,500 kilograms and up to 8 traveler seats. This classification represents what most of chauffeurs pursue when learning to drive.

Beyond Category B, many specialized licences exist for various lorry types. Category An allows motorbike riding, while Category C enables operation of big items automobiles over 3,500 kilograms, and Category D covers passenger-carrying lorries like buses. Each category has its own eligibility requirements, screening procedures, and minimum age restrictions. For more recent drivers, it makes good sense to focus initially on the Category B licence before thinking about extra recommendations.

The provisional licence serves as the necessary starting point for anyone discovering to drive in the UK. This file authorises supervised practice on public roads, requiring the holder to show unique L-plates on their vehicle at all times. Provisionary licence holders need to be accompanied by a certified driver who has held a complete licence for the relevant vehicle category for a minimum of 3 years and is aged 21 or older. The provisional duration continues until the Driver License UK passes both the theory and practical driving tests.

The Application Process for Your First UK Licence

Getting a provisional driving licence represents the very first official step towards independent driving. Candidates must be at least 15 years and 9 months old to use, though they can not really drive on public roads until reaching 16. The application can be completed online through the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) website or by finishing the D1 application available at post workplace branches.

The application needs numerous pieces of individual documents, consisting of proof of identity such as a valid passport, addresses where the candidate has lived over the past 3 years, and a passport-sized photo that fulfills particular guidelines. The present cost for a provisionary licence is ₤ 34 when applying online or ₤ 43 through the postal method. The DVLA typically processes online applications within one week, while postal applications may take up to three weeks.

When the provisional licence gets here, the genuine learning begins. Many learners select to take expert driving lessons from approved trainers, though discovering with member of the family or friends is also allowed under particular conditions. The typical student needs roughly 45 hours of expert direction combined with additional private practice before reaching test-ready proficiency, though this differs substantially based upon individual ability and confidence.

The Theory and Practical Testing Requirements

Before scheduling a practical driving test, every prospect needs to pass the theory test, which comprises two unique parts. The multiple-choice area tests understanding of the Highway Code, roadway signs, driving theory, and safety considerations. This section includes 50 questions, and candidates need to achieve a minimum rating of 43 to pass. The threat perception element presents 14 video clips including developing road scenarios, needing test-takers to identify possible dangers by clicking at proper moments. A passing rating of 44 out of 75 is required in this section.

The useful driving test assesses real-world driving ability under the guidance of an authorized examiner. The test lasts roughly 40 minutes and includes different driving maneuvers consisting of reverse parking, emergency situation stops, and independent driving areas where candidates follow road indications or verbal directions. Test centres carry out dry runs daily except Sundays and public holidays, with wait times varying by place.

Upon passing the dry run, candidates get a complete provisional licence that authorises independent driving. However, brand-new chauffeurs should follow specific limitations during the initial two-year probationary period. These consist of a lower alcohol limitation of 35 micrograms per 100 millilitres of breath compared to the basic 80 micrograms for experienced chauffeurs, and instant penalty points for specific offenses that would generally result in fines.

Renewing and Updating Your UK Driving Licence

UK driving licences stay legitimate until the holder reaches age 70, after which renewal ends up being required every three years. Nevertheless, licence updates might be needed previously under specific scenarios. Any changes to individual details, consisting of name, gender, or address, should be reported to the DVLA within a defined timeframe. Failing to upgrade the licence can result in fines of up to ₤ 1,000.

The DVLA immediately sends out reminder letters roughly 3 months before a licence expires, though drivers can likewise initiate renewal online as much as 90 days before expiry. The online renewal procedure needs a valid UK passport or other identity document, the existing licence number, and addresses for the past three years. The standard renewal cost is ₤ 14 when finished online.

Medical conditions that affect driving ability should be declared when they develop, regardless of age. Particular conditions including epilepsy, severe diabetes, heart conditions, and numerous visual disabilities require particular declarations and may require medical documents. Driving with an undeclared medical condition that impacts safe operation carries considerable charges and revokes insurance protection.

Regularly Asked Questions About UK Driving Licences

Can I drive in the UK with a foreign driving licence?

Visitors from acknowledged countries can drive in the UK utilizing their valid foreign licence for as much as 12 months. After this duration, either a UK licence should be obtained or the foreign licence needs to be exchanged, depending upon whether the driver's nation has a reciprocal contract with the UK. People from EU and EEA nations can exchange their licences for equivalent UK categories without going through testing, while chauffeurs from non-EU countries normally need to pass both theory and dry runs.

How do I exchange my EU driving licence for a UK licence?

EU licence holders can exchange their licence at any DVLA regional office without needing extra tests. The exchange process needs completing application form D1, offering original identification, submitting the existing licence, and paying the ₤ 43 administrative charge. The DVLA will return the initial licence to the issuing nation and release a UK licence in exchange. This process typically takes around one week for licences in acceptable condition.

What takes place if I lose my driving licence?

Lost or stolen licences can be replaced through the DVLA online service or by completing form D1. The replacement fee is ₤ 20 when applications are submitted online, rising to ₤ 22 for postal applications. If the loss occurred due to theft, obtaining an authorities crime referral number might be advisable for insurance coverage and identity confirmation functions.

The length of time do penalty points remain on my driving licence?

Penalty points, also understood as recommendation points, stay on a driving licence for either 4 or 11 years depending upon the offense. Minor offences like speeding normally result in 3 points staying for 4 years, while serious offences such as drink-driving can result in 11-year endorsements.
